Kaneski v. Kaneski

Citations

  • 604 A.2d 1075
  • 413 Pa. Super. 173
  • 1992 Pa. Super. LEXIS 970

How courts have described this case

Verbatim parenthetical descriptions written by other courts when citing this decision. Ranked by citation-network relevance.

  • stating that once real advantages to the custodial parent and children have been shown, it becomes necessary to shift visitation arrangements so long as reasonable substitute visitation is available
